Why We Settle for Almost-Relationships IF YOU HAVE TO KEEP WONDERING WHERE IT’S GOING, THAT MAY BE YOUR ANSWER. Situationships can feel complicated, but most of the time, the confusion isn't the real problem. The problem is that we’re afraid of what clarity might tell us. In this solo episode of Wind in Her Hair, Ana breaks down situationships, breadcrumbing, emotional ambiguity, and why so many people stay invested in relationships that aren't actually progressing. Ana shares a recent experience with a man who suggested they could “just have fun” while they both waited for their forever person to come along. Years ago, she might have entertained it. Today, the answer was simple: Why spend your most precious asset—your time—on someone you already know has no future with you? She explains the difference between a relationship that hasn't been defined yet and a situationship that is intentionally staying undefined. In a healthy developing relationship, effort and clarity increase over time. In a situationship, ambiguity allows someone to have attention, intimacy, affection, and access to you without the responsibility of commitment. Ana also breaks down why we settle for breadcrumbs, the excuses we make when we don't want to face what someone's behavior is telling us, and the red-flag phrases that keep people stuck in the gray area. You'll learn how to ask the direct question, use the 48-hour test to determine whether someone's behavior matches their words, and stop dating someone's potential instead of paying attention to their patterns. Finally, Ana walks through eight practical steps for leaving a situationship, removing access, grieving the fantasy of what you hoped the relationship could become, and rebuilding a life you actually enjoy.
